In two separate incidents of carelessness, two youngsters died because of overeating and self-medication.
In an incident relating to neglect and carelessness, a young man who resorted to YouTube to get relief for his toothache, died after following an advisory from watching a YouTube video.
Ajay Mahto of Jharkand is the youth who allegedly succumbed to death after consuming oleander seeds as a remedy for his toothache after watching it as a remedy on a YouTube video. Oleander seeds are believed to be dangerous and life-threatening if consumed.
Self-medication is not always advisable to treat any ailment. Consultation from doctors is highly recommended.
In another similar incident of carelessness in Bihar, a youth died of mindlessly overeating over his friends’ bid to reward the one who ate highest number of momos.
Vipin Kumar, a youth from Bihar ate around 150 momos in an attempt to win his friends’ competition bid and succumbed as he consumed over 100 momos one after the other.
